IIS7站长之家-站长工具-爱网站请使用IIS7站长综合查询工具,中国站长【WWW.IIS7.COM】

當前位置 主頁 > 技術(shù)大全 >

    Linux chmod命令:管理子目錄權(quán)限
    linux chmod 子目錄

    欄目:技術(shù)大全 時間:2024-12-06 21:29



    Linux`chmod` 命令在子目錄管理中的應用與重要性 在Linux操作系統(tǒng)中,文件和目錄的權(quán)限管理是一項至關(guān)重要的任務

        權(quán)限控制不僅關(guān)乎系統(tǒng)的安全性,還直接影響到用戶能否正常訪問和修改文件內(nèi)容

        而`chmod`命令作為Linux中用于更改文件或目錄權(quán)限的核心工具,其重要性不言而喻

        特別是在管理復雜的目錄結(jié)構(gòu)時,如何正確地使用`chmod`命令來設(shè)置子目錄的權(quán)限,成為了每位Linux系統(tǒng)管理員必須掌握的技能

        本文將深入探討`chmod`命令在子目錄管理中的應用及其重要性,并提供詳細的操作指南

         一、理解Linux權(quán)限模型 在深入探討`chmod`命令之前,有必要先了解Linux的權(quán)限模型

        Linux采用基于用戶(User)、組(Group)和其他人(Others)的權(quán)限劃分機制

        每個文件和目錄都有三組權(quán)限:讀(Read, r)、寫(Write, w)和執(zhí)行(Execute, x)

         讀權(quán)限(r):允許查看文件內(nèi)容或列出目錄內(nèi)容

         - 寫權(quán)限(w):允許修改文件內(nèi)容或向目錄中添加、刪除文件

         執(zhí)行權(quán)限(x):允許執(zhí)行文件或進入目錄

         這些權(quán)限通過數(shù)字表示法(八進制)或符號表示法來設(shè)置

        數(shù)字表示法中,4代表讀權(quán)限,2代表寫權(quán)限,1代表執(zhí)行權(quán)限,組合使用這些數(shù)字可以表示不同的權(quán)限組合,如7(4+2+1)表示讀寫執(zhí)行權(quán)限全開

         二、`chmod`命令基礎(chǔ) `chmod`命令用于改變文件或目錄的權(quán)限

        它有兩種主要的權(quán)限設(shè)置方式:符號表示法和數(shù)字表示法

         1.符號表示法: -`chmod u+rwxfile`:給用戶增加讀寫執(zhí)行權(quán)限

         -`chmod g-w file`:移除組的寫權(quán)限

         -`chmod o=r file`:設(shè)置其他人的權(quán)限為只讀

         -`chmod a+x file`:給所有用戶(用戶、組、其他人)增加執(zhí)行權(quán)限

         2.數(shù)字表示法: -`chmod 755file`:設(shè)置文件權(quán)限為用戶讀寫執(zhí)行(7),組讀執(zhí)行(5),其他人讀執(zhí)行(5)

         -`chmod 644directory`:設(shè)置目錄權(quán)限為用戶讀寫(6),組讀(4),其他人讀(4)

         三、遞歸更改子目錄權(quán)限 在Linux中,如果需要更改一個目錄及其所有子目錄和文件的權(quán)限,`chmod`命令的`-R`(或`--recursive`)選項就顯得尤為重要

        這個選項讓`chmod`命令能夠遞歸地應用到指定的目錄及其所有子目錄和文件上

         示例場景: 假設(shè)你有一個項目目錄`/var/www/project`,你希望將該目錄及其所有子目錄和文件的權(quán)限設(shè)置為用戶讀寫執(zhí)行(7),組讀執(zhí)行(5),其他人無權(quán)限(0)

         命令: chmod -R 750 /var/www/project 這條命令會更改`/var/www/project`目錄及其所有子目錄和文件的權(quán)限,確保只有擁有者(用戶)擁有完全的權(quán)限,而組成員只能讀取和執(zhí)行,其他人則沒有任何權(quán)限

         四、實際應用中的注意事項 1.避免權(quán)限過寬: - 給予過于寬泛的權(quán)限可能導致安全漏洞

        例如,給所有人寫權(quán)限(`chmod -R 777`)會允許任何用戶修改目錄內(nèi)容,這是非常危險的

         2.合理設(shè)置目錄執(zhí)行權(quán)限: - 目錄的執(zhí)行權(quán)限(x)對于訪問目錄內(nèi)的文件至關(guān)重要

        如果目錄沒有執(zhí)行權(quán)限,即使文件有讀權(quán)限,用戶也無法訪問這些文件

         3.使用find命令輔助: - 對于更復雜的權(quán)限調(diào)整需求,可以結(jié)合`find`命令來實現(xiàn)

        例如,只更改特定類型的文件權(quán)限,或者根據(jù)文件的修改時間進行權(quán)限調(diào)整

         示例:更改所有.sh腳本文件的權(quán)限為750: find /var/www/project -type f -name.sh -exec chmod 750 {} ; 4.考慮SELinux或AppArmor: - 在一些企業(yè)級Linux發(fā)行版中,SELinux(Security-Enhanced Linux)或AppArmor提供了額外的安全層

        在調(diào)整權(quán)限時,應確保這些安全策略不會與`chmod`命令沖突

         5.日志記錄與監(jiān)控: - 對于關(guān)鍵目錄的權(quán)限更改,建議記錄日志并設(shè)置監(jiān)控,以便及時發(fā)現(xiàn)并響應未經(jīng)授權(quán)的權(quán)限更改

         五、權(quán)限管理最佳實踐 1.最小權(quán)限原則: - 只授予用戶完成特定任務所需的最小權(quán)限

        這有助于減少潛在的安全風險

         2.定期審查權(quán)限: - 定期檢查系統(tǒng)上的權(quán)限設(shè)置,確保它們符合當前的安全策略和業(yè)務需求

         3.使用ACLs(訪問控制列表): - 對于更細粒度的權(quán)限控制,可以考慮使用ACLs

        ACLs允許為單個用戶或組設(shè)置特定的權(quán)限,而無需更改整個目錄或文件的默認權(quán)限

         4.文檔化權(quán)限策略: - 制定并維護一份詳細的權(quán)限管理文檔,記錄每個目錄和文件的預期權(quán)限設(shè)置及其原因

         六、總結(jié) `chmod`命令是Linux系統(tǒng)中管理文件和目錄權(quán)限的基礎(chǔ)工具

        通過合理使用`chmod`命令,特別是其遞歸選項`-R`,系統(tǒng)管理員可以有效地管理復雜的目錄結(jié)構(gòu),確保系統(tǒng)安全性和用戶訪問權(quán)限的合理性

        然而,權(quán)限管理并非一蹴而就,它需要持續(xù)的監(jiān)控、審查和調(diào)整

        遵循最小權(quán)限原則,結(jié)合ACLs、SELinux或AppArmor等安全機制,可以構(gòu)建一個既安全又高效的Linux系統(tǒng)環(huán)境

         在Linux的世界里,權(quán)限管理不僅是系統(tǒng)安全的基石,更是確保系統(tǒng)穩(wěn)定運行和用戶高效工作的關(guān)鍵

        掌握`chmod`命令及其在各種場景下的應用,對于每位Linux系統(tǒng)管理員來說,都是一項不可或缺的技能

        

主站蜘蛛池模板: 真空搅拌机-行星搅拌机-双行星动力混合机-广州市番禺区源创化工设备厂 | 设定时间记录电子秤-自动累计储存电子秤-昆山巨天仪器设备有限公司 | 焊接烟尘净化器__焊烟除尘设备_打磨工作台_喷漆废气治理设备 -催化燃烧设备 _天津路博蓝天环保科技有限公司 | 手机存放柜,超市储物柜,电子储物柜,自动寄存柜,行李寄存柜,自动存包柜,条码存包柜-上海天琪实业有限公司 | 登车桥动力单元-非标液压泵站-非标液压系统-深圳市三好科技有限公司 | 网站建设,北京网站建设,北京网站建设公司,网站系统开发,北京网站制作公司,响应式网站,做网站公司,海淀做网站,朝阳做网站,昌平做网站,建站公司 | 海外整合营销-独立站营销-社交媒体运营_广州甲壳虫跨境网络服务 焊管生产线_焊管机组_轧辊模具_焊管设备_焊管设备厂家_石家庄翔昱机械 | 重庆私家花园设计-别墅花园-庭院-景观设计-重庆彩木园林建设有限公司 | 河南档案架,档案密集架,手动密集架,河南密集架批发/报价 | 济南ISO9000认证咨询代理公司,ISO9001认证,CMA实验室认证,ISO/TS16949认证,服务体系认证,资产管理体系认证,SC食品生产许可证- 济南创远企业管理咨询有限公司 郑州电线电缆厂家-防火|低压|低烟无卤电缆-河南明星电缆 | 砂磨机_立式纳米砂磨机_实验室砂磨机-广州儒佳化工设备厂家 | 黑龙江京科脑康医院-哈尔滨精神病医院哪家好_哈尔滨精神科医院排名_黑龙江精神心理病专科医院 | 五轴加工中心_数控加工中心_铝型材加工中心-罗威斯 | EDLC超级法拉电容器_LIC锂离子超级电容_超级电容模组_软包单体电容电池_轴向薄膜电力电容器_深圳佳名兴电容有限公司_JMX专注中高端品牌电容生产厂家 | 建大仁科-温湿度变送器|温湿度传感器|温湿度记录仪_厂家_价格-山东仁科 | Dataforth隔离信号调理模块-信号放大模块-加速度振动传感器-北京康泰电子有限公司 | 华东师范大学在职研究生招生网_在职研究生招生联展网 | 河南空气能热水器-洛阳空气能采暖-洛阳太阳能热水工程-洛阳润达高科空气能商行 | 达利园物流科技集团- | 领袖户外_深度旅游、摄影旅游、小团慢旅行、驴友网 | 液压升降平台_剪叉式液压/导轨式升降机_传菜机定做「宁波日腾升降机厂家」 | 千淘酒店差旅平台-中国第一家针对TMC行业的酒店资源供应平台 | 车间除尘设备,VOCs废气处理,工业涂装流水线,伸缩式喷漆房,自动喷砂房,沸石转轮浓缩吸附,机器人喷粉线-山东创杰智慧 | 泥沙分离_泥沙分离设备_泥砂分离机_洛阳隆中重工机械有限公司 | 播音主持培训-中影人教育播音主持学苑「官网」-中国艺考界的贵族学校 | 车件|铜件|车削件|车床加工|五金冲压件-PIN针,精密车件定制专业厂商【东莞品晔】 | 海水晶,海水素,海水晶价格-潍坊滨海经济开发区强隆海水晶厂 | 移动厕所租赁|移动卫生间|上海移动厕所租赁-家瑞租赁 | 成都网站建设制作_高端网站设计公司「做网站送优化推广」 | 单柱拉力机-橡胶冲片机-哑铃裁刀-江都轩宇试验机械厂 | 免费分销系统 — 分销商城系统_分销小程序开发 -【微商来】 | 洁净棚-洁净工作棚-无菌室-净化工程公司_北京卫护科技有限公司 | 苏州教学设备-化工教学设备-环境工程教学模型|同科教仪 | 有机肥设备生产制造厂家,BB掺混肥搅拌机、复合肥设备生产线,有机肥料全部加工设备多少钱,对辊挤压造粒机,有机肥造粒设备 -- 郑州程翔重工机械有限公司 | 全自动真空上料机_粉末真空上料机_气动真空上料机-南京奥威环保科技设备有限公司 | 布袋式除尘器|木工除尘器|螺旋输送机|斗式提升机|刮板输送机|除尘器配件-泊头市德佳环保设备 | 鲁尔圆锥接头多功能测试仪-留置针测试仪-上海威夏环保科技有限公司 | 台湾Apex减速机_APEX行星减速机_台湾精锐减速机厂家代理【现货】-杭州摩森机电 | 浙江建筑资质代办_二级房建_市政_电力_安许_劳务资质办理公司 | 烟台条码打印机_烟台条码扫描器_烟台碳带_烟台数据采集终端_烟台斑马打印机-金鹏电子-金鹏电子 | 上海皓越真空设备有限公司官网-真空炉-真空热压烧结炉-sps放电等离子烧结炉 |